What is a Lien on a Bank Account?
A lien is a legal claim or restriction placed on your account by the bank to secure funds, usually due to:
-
Cyber fraud complaints or suspicious transactions.
-
Pending investigations under IPC Section 420 or IT Act Sections 66C/66D.
-
Court or police directions to safeguard funds involved in alleged crimes.
-
Loan defaults or third-party disputes in some cases.
A lien restricts withdrawal or transfer of funds until authorities provide clearance.
How Can a Lawyer Help Remove a Lien?
A skilled cyber crime lawyer can guide you in obtaining a court order to remove the lien efficiently:
Steps Involved:
-
Case Review – Analyze why the lien was imposed and review bank and police notices.
-
Evidence Collection – Gather transaction history, invoices, contracts, and proof of legitimate funds.
-
Drafting Petition – File an application under Section 451/457 CrPC or a writ petition under Article 226 in High Court.
-
Court Representation – Argue the case, emphasizing wrongful lien and violation of fundamental rights.
-
Execution of Order – Ensure the bank and authorities comply with the court’s decision.

Safety Tips from Advocate Deepak
-
Avoid using your bank account for unknown or third-party transactions.
-
Maintain transparent records of all online transfers.
-
Verify investment, gaming, and job portals before sending money.
-
Report any suspicious activity immediately to the Cyber Crime Helpline (1930).
